#230511 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#230511 is composed of 13.7% red, 2%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 86.3% black. It has a hue angle of 336 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 7.8%. #230511 color hex could be obtained by blending #460a22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#230511 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#230511 has RGB values of R:35, G:5,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.51,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 2295057.

Shades and Tints of #230511
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deff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#230511
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#151314 is the less saturated color, while #280010 is the most saturated one.
